About Dr. Siddharth Sheth

Dr. Siddharth Sheth is a board-certified medical oncologist and a tenure-track Assistant Professor of Medicine in the Division of Medical Oncology with a secondary appointment in the Department of Otolaryngology at the University of North Carolina (UNC) at Chapel Hill. Dr. Sheth's clinical expertise is in the treatment of head and neck cancers (HNC) and thyroid cancers. Hid research focuses on early phase clinical trials and evaluating promising biomarkers.

At UNC, Dr. Sheth is a member of their dynamic head and neck cancer research program. He lead multiple clinical trials, many which are evaluating novel combinations of immunotherapy and targeted therapies. To complement this work, Dr. Sheth has developed a keen interest in non-invasive biomarkers, specifically circulating tumor DNA (ctDNA). Supported by an ASCO/Conquer Cancer Foundation Young Investigator Award (YIA; 2019) and 2021 NIH Paul Calabresi K12 Career Development Award in Clinical Oncology, he is studying if ctDNA can be an effective tool to monitor for treatment response and disease recurrence.

Dr. Sheth greatly enjoys caring for his HNC and thyroid cancer patients. The multidisciplinary team at UNC is deeply committed to providing the best care and support for their patients. By designing and leading clinical trials and translational studies, Dr. Sheth hope to positively impact his patient’s disease outcomes and their quality of life.
